Ready e-Invoicing SuiteApp in NetSuite 2024.2 Release Notes
Discover the Ready e-Invoicing SuiteApp in NetSuite 2024.2, enabling outbound purchase orders through datapost access point.
Starting in NetSuite 2024.2, the Ready e-Invoicing SuiteApp has been introduced, enhancing the functionality of managing invoices. This SuiteApp allows users to send outbound purchase orders through the datapost access point, streamlining the e-invoicing process and enhancing data accuracy in transactions.
Key Features
- Outbound Purchase Orders: The primary enhancement with this SuiteApp is the ability to send outbound purchase orders effectively.
- Datapost Access Point: Users can utilize this access point to manage their e-documents seamlessly.
- Integration with Components: The SuiteApp integrates with various e-document components and records, ensuring all invoices are accurately processed.

Note: Remember that outbound purchase orders can only be sent through the datapost access point. For further details on the components involved, refer to the related help topics.
